Oregon Transporting Firearms Laws (2026)

Without a CHL, it is unlawful to have a concealed and readily accessible handgun in a vehicle; transport it unloaded and not readily accessible (e.g., locked trunk or container). A CHL allows a loaded concealed handgun.

Official source: oregonlegislature.gov
